#!/usr/bin/env ruby
#/ Usage: ./run [--local] [-p N] [[YYYY] DD | INPUT... | SCRIPT...]
#/ Run all scripts for the specified day of Advent of Code.
#/ Default is today.
#/ --local skips downloading the input.
#/ -p sets the max number of scripts that run in parallel. By default there is
#/ no limit.
#/
#/ For example, for day 1 of 2020, you might name inputs like:
#/ 2020/examples/01.simple.txt
#/ 2020/examples/01.complex.txt
#/ 2020/input/01.txt
#/ And scripts like:
#/ 2020/01.rb
#/ 2020/py/01.py
require "fileutils"
require "net/http"
require "thread"
require "uri"
def main(year: nil, day: nil, inputs: nil, scripts: nil, local: false, p: nil)
if year.nil?
year, day = get_date(day: day, inputs: inputs, scripts: scripts)
elsif day.nil?
raise ArgumentError, "Year specified without day."
end
inputs, scripts = scan_files(inputs: inputs, scripts: scripts, local: local, year: year, day: day)
if inputs.empty? || scripts.empty?
puts "!!! Nothing to do!"
exit 0
end
c = {}
t = []
q = []
t << str_bg("======= Line counts =======")
t << Thread.new { `wc -l #{scripts.join(" ")} 2>&1` }
inputs.each do |input|
t << str_bg("======= #{input} =======")
scripts.each do |script|
w = p.nil? ? nil : Queue.new
q << w if w
t << str_bg(">>> #{script} < #{input}")
t << run_bg(script: script, input: input, c: c, w: w)
t << w if w
t << str_bg("")
end
end
p.times { q.shift&.enq :go } unless p.nil?
t.each do |x|
case x
when Queue
q.shift&.enq :go
else
puts x.value
end
end
end
def get_date(day:, inputs:, scripts:)
if day
return Time.now.year, day
end
((inputs || []) + (scripts || [])).each do |filename|
if info = derive_date(filename)
return info
end
end
now = Time.now
[now.year, now.day]
end
def derive_date(filename)
year = nil
day = nil
filename.split("/").each do |part|
if year.nil? && part =~ /\A\d{4}\z/
year = part.to_i
end
if day.nil? && part =~ /\A\d{1,2}(\D|\z)/
day = part.to_i
end
end
if year && day
[year.to_i, day.to_i]
end
end
def scan_files(inputs:, scripts:, local:, year:, day:)
return [inputs, scripts] if inputs && scripts
found_inputs = []
found_scripts = []
Dir["**/*"].each do |file|
case typeof(file, year: year, day: day)
when :input
found_inputs << file
when :script
found_scripts << file
end
end
download_input = inputs.nil? && !local && !found_inputs.any? { |input| input =~ /input/ }
if download_input
begin
token = File.read(".token").strip
puts "Downloading input..."
uri = URI("https://adventofcode.com/#{year}/day/#{day}/input")
Net::HTTP.start(uri.host, uri.port, use_ssl: true) do |http|
req = Net::HTTP::Get.new(uri)
req["Cookie"] = "session=#{token}"
resp = http.request(req)
if resp.code != "200"
puts "Error downloading input (HTTP #{resp.code}):"
puts resp.body
else
input_file = sprintf("%04d/input/%02d.txt", year, day)
FileUtils.mkdir_p(File.dirname(input_file))
File.write(input_file, resp.body)
found_inputs << input_file
end
end
rescue Errno::ENOENT
puts "!!!HINT!!! Create a .token file with your session token and I will"
puts "!!!HINT!!! download the input file for you!"
end
end
[inputs || found_inputs, scripts || found_scripts]
end
def str_bg(str)
Thread.new { str }
end
def run_bg(script:, input:, c:, w:)
case File.extname(script)
when ".rb"
Thread.new { w&.deq; capture_output "ruby", script, in: input }
when ".py"
Thread.new { w&.deq; capture_output "python3", script, in: input }
when ".rs"
c_th = c[script]
if c_th.nil?
c_th = c[script] = compile_bg(script) { |out_file| ["rustc", "-O", "-o", out_file, script] }
end
Thread.new do
w&.deq
res = c_th.value
if res.ok?
# warm up
system res.bin, in: "/dev/null", out: "/dev/null", err: "/dev/null"
capture_output res.bin, in: input
else
res.output
end
end
when ".go"
c_th = c[script]
if c_th.nil?
c_th = c[script] = compile_bg(script) { |out_file| ["go", "build", "-o", out_file, script] }
end
Thread.new do
w&.deq
res = c_th.value
if res.ok?
# warm up
system res.bin, in: "/dev/null", out: "/dev/null", err: "/dev/null"
capture_output res.bin, in: input
else
res.output
end
end
else
puts "Unrecognized script extension."
end
end
def capture_output(*cmd, **opts)
cmd = [{"IS_REAL_INPUT" => "Y"}] + cmd if opts[:in] =~ /input/
capture_output2(*cmd, **opts).first
end
def capture_output2(*cmd, **opts)
r, w = IO.pipe
start = Time.now
pid = spawn(*cmd, **opts, out: w, err: w)
w.close
res = r.read
elapsed = Time.now - start
r.close
_, status = Process.wait2(pid)
[
sprintf("%s> elapsed: %d ms\n", res, 1000 * elapsed),
status,
]
end
def compile_bg(script)
bin = ".output/#{script}"
cmd = yield bin
Thread.new do
system "mkdir", "-p", File.dirname(bin)
output, status = capture_output2(*cmd)
Result.new \
status: status,
output: output,
bin: bin
end
end
class Result
def initialize(status:, output:, bin:)
@status = status
@output = output
@bin = bin
end
attr_reader :output, :bin
def ok?
@status.success?
end
end
def typeof(file, year:, day:)
parts = file.split("/")
return :wrong_year unless parts.any? { |part| part.to_i == year }
return :wrong_day unless parts.any? { |part| part.to_i == day }
return :input if parts.include?("input") || parts.include?("examples")
return :script
end
options = {}
if ARGV.delete("--local")
options[:local] = true
end
if i = ARGV.index("-p")
ARGV.delete_at(i)
options[:p] = ARGV.delete_at(i).to_i
if options[:p] < 1
raise "illegal value for -p"
end
end
def usage
File.readlines(__FILE__).grep(/^#\//).each { |line| puts line[3..-1] }
end
options = {}
until ARGV.empty?
case arg = ARGV.shift
when "--local"
options[:local] = true
when "-p"
options[:p] = ARGV.shift.to_i
when /\A-/
usage
exit 1
when /\A\d{4}\z/
options[:year] = arg.to_i
when /\A\d{1,2}\z/
options[:day] = arg.to_i
when /example/, /input/
(options[:inputs] ||= []) << arg
else
(options[:scripts] ||= []) << arg
end
end
if options[:year] && options[:day].nil?
usage
exit 1
end
main(**options)
